The ATC modernization project will address HVAC deficiencies, Telecom decentralization and a refresh of building spaces. A new mechanical system is being installed. The removal and replacement of all air-handling units with duct cleaning and limited duct replacement. A new roof is being installed due to the extent of the deterioration of the roof. The bathrooms are being renovated to meet current codes and receive new finishes, and the interior is receiving new paint and floor finishes. Full exterior lighting replacement and select interior lighting replacement is also be provided. This project is using the Lease-Leaseback Delivery method. Pre-construction began in August 2012. The project completion date is November 2013. The budget of this project is $10.7 million.

Corporation Yard
The Corporation Yard Renovation project is complete. The project re-configured existing space within the building and fenced yard. Plant, grounds and Custodial services now occupy the building.
The building provides much needed shop warehouse and office space. Changes to the yard included eliminating a seldom used loading dock, drainage and circulation improvements with designated locations for recycling bins, equipment storage an electric cart parking. Canopy solar panels and sky lights were included to reduce energy consumption. Cart charging stations and parking will be located under the photovoltaic canopies. Project budget was $3.4 million.

Update: Bond committee notes Measure C progress, wise spending
The 2010-2011 report of the Citizens' Bond Oversight Committee noted significant progress on projects and that the district is in compliance with all legal requirements.
